Allison Eloise Medley Allison, age 100, of Columbus, died peacefully on Thursday, June 27, 2013 at Wesley Glen Retirement Community. Born in Hickman County, KY to N.M. and Mary Medley. Longtime member and former parish secretary at Trinity Episcopal Church. Member of the Worthington Chapter - Daughters of the American Revolution and the Arlington Unit of The Women's Symphony Organization. An avid amateur photographer, Eloise traveled around the world on camera safaris with her gypsy friends. Preceded in death by husband James Ralph Allison, son George B.
